MTrec’s New Opportunity;MTrec Technical are proudly representing our prestigious manufacturing client, based in Stockton-on-Tees, by recruiting a new NPI Quality Engineer, to join their growing team. A successful candidate will be responsible for preparing all relevant qualitydocumentation for PPAP, ISIR, testing or any customer specified requirements and also generate all internal documents necessary for a smooth launch into volume production. Development of any gauging requirements and measurement techniques.If you are an experienced NPI Quality Engineer, with a background in Automotive/Injection Moulding experience and looking for your next career move, apply now for an immediate response!The Job You’ll Do;
  • Manage multiple NPI projects simultaneously.
  • Front line liaison with customers at all stages of the NPI process.
  • Create, control and submit all APQP documentation.
  • Liaise with suppliers and customers to ensure all APQP requirements are met.
  • Complete IMDS.
  • Take part in site visits - tooling, suppliers and customers.
  • Take part in all relevant internal and external NPI meetings.
  • Create gauge concepts - liaise with gauge maker to ensure gauges are available for applicable trials and are validate
About You;
  • Excellent time management and communication skills.
  • High level of attention to detail.
  • Minimum HNC level education.
  • Project management skills.
  • APQP experience.
  • Computer skills.
  • Ability to read, translate and feedback on drawings (GD&T).
  • Willingness to travel in line with duties.
  • Must possess a full driving licence.
